放射性脑损伤的病理改变与认知障碍的磁共振成像研究进展 被引量:2

Research progress of MRI on pathological changes and cognitive impairment of radiation-induced brain injury

摘要 认知障碍是放射性脑损伤最常见的临床表现,主要依据临床表现与神经心理学量表诊断,临床上尚无法做到早期诊断。放疗后认知障碍的发展与放射性脑损伤的病理过程相关。本文综述了放疗后认知障碍相关的病理过程与MRI在放疗后认知障碍应用的最新进展,总结了不同序列放射性脑损伤的早期影像学表现和相对应的病理改变,以及基于MRI的人工智能和影像组学在预测放疗后认知障碍患者的应用,并基于此提出人工智能和影像组学结合多序列MRI早期诊断放疗后认知障碍的研究方向,有助于临床早期准确识别放疗后认知障碍患者并尽早干预,提升患者生活质量。 Cognitive function impairment is the most common clinical manifestation of radiation-induced brain injury.The diagnosis is mainly based on clinical features and neuropsychological scales.The process of cognitive function impairment after radiotherapy is related to the pathological changes.This article reviews the latest progress in the pathological processes related to cognitive function impairment after radiotherapy and the application of MRI.It summarizes the early imaging manifestations and corresponding pathological changes of radiation-induced brain injury in different sequences,and the application of artificial intelligence and radiomics based on MRI in predicting patients with cognitive function impairment after radiotherapy.Based on this,the research direction of artificial intelligence and radiomics combined with multi-sequence MRI for early diagnosis of cognitive function impairment after radiotherapy is proposed,which is helpful for early and accurate identification of patients with cognitive function impairment after radiotherapy and early intervention to improve the quality of life of patients.
